Abstract

This article describes the detailed configuration and LAN infrastructure design at the University of Bahrain (UOB). The article describes the configuration based on the new setup and migration requirements and indicates how the design satisfies those requirements. The article explains the detailed configuration of the design process of the distribution layer switches and shows how these switches can be configured in the final implementation. The article also discusses the modifications that occurred during the implementation/migration phase. The design of the network at UOB campuses incorporates resiliency into the network core in order to manage problems effectively. This will enable user access points to remain connected to the network even in the event of a failure. This incorporation aims to provide services and benefits to users without impediments.
